Coral Gables Mayor Vince Lago has business with accused money launderer

The land-use attorney and lobbyist arrested Thursday on money laundering, criminal conspiracy and political corruption charges also has business ties with Coral Gables Mayor Vince Lago.

William “Bill” Riley Jr. was one of the four real estate agents registered along with Lago at the brokerage owned by former Hialeah Councilman Oscar de la Rosa, who is the stepson of Hialeah Mayor Esteban Bovo. Bovo is another real estate agent with the firm. So is Lago’s chief of staff, Chelsea Granell. The brokerage received a $640,000 commission from the sale of a Ponce de Leon Boulevard building to Location Ventures, the same development firm that is being investigated for its $10,000 monthly payments to Miami Mayor Francis Suarez for “consulting.”
